fuzzy navel

noun

Etymology

There are several theories about when and where the drink was invented, but it gets its name from the fuzz of the peach and the navel orange used to make it.

Definitions

  1. A cocktail, usually made with peach schnapps and orange juice.

    • She ordered two fuzzy navels.

    A drink or food (of a specified type) which imitates this cocktail by featuring peach and orange as central flavours (with or without alcohol).

    • fuzzy navel milkshake, fuzzy navel cake, fuzzy navel pie
    • And you can find menus with imagination: like "Jan's Restaurant's" chuck wagon soup and fuzzy navel pie ... a combination of peaches and orange juice.
